Description

This beautiful Morningside Lane Estate Series Plan home located in Sun City was built on a preferred lot backing up to private wooded property and leads into a cul-de-sac. This home has had one owner and it has all the upgrades and features you can imagine. Two of the bedrooms have on suite bathrooms for the ultimate guest accommodations. The square footage includes a 56sq ft butler pantry add-on with a commercial freezer and wine refrigerator (Buyer to verify square footage). Roof replaced and exterior painted in 2021, 120k Texas sized patio addition with tongue and grooved ceiling, outdoor TV, and outdoor kitchen including a gas grill and mini fridge. $50k worth of xeriscaping, flagstone walkways, drip irrigation and water feature. Built in entertainment center with under cabinet accent lighting and additional storage, updated laundry room with sink and cabinets (washer and dryer convey). 4' extended 2 car garage with built-in shelves a breeze screen and room for a golf cart. Kitchen has granite countertops, travertine backsplash, eat in island, KitchenAid appliances, custom roll out cabinetry, large walk in pantry and a solar tube ceiling. Primary suite has a soaking tub with separate shower, dual vanities, extra-large walk-in closet and wiring for TV in bedroom and bathroom. Nest smoke/co2 detectors, doorbell and lock on front door. Plantation shutters, extra storage/lighting/cabinetry, tray ceilings, wood and tile flooring throughout. Sun City offers the ultimate active senior living lifestyle with amenities such as 3 private golf courses, fitness centers, pools, fishing ponds, walking trails, parks with green space, library, dog park,tennis and pickleball courts and more!
